commit 452690be7de2f91cc0de68cb9e95252875b33503 upstream. This modification is linked to the parent commit where the received ADD_ADDR limit was accidentally reset when the endpoints were flushed. To validate that, the test is now flushing endpoints after having set new limits, and before checking them. The 'Fixes' tag here below is the same as the one from the previous commit: this patch here is not fixing anything wrong in the selftests, but it validates the previous fix for an issue introduced by this commit ID.
